What are Eco-Friendly Shoes?
Eco-friendly shoes, also called sustainable or environmentally friendly shoes, are footwear produced with materials and processes that minimize their impact on the planet. Unlike traditional shoes that can be made with polluting synthetic materials and unsustainable production methods, eco-friendly shoes are designed to be more environmentally friendly at every stage of their life cycle, from production to end-of-life.
The Advantages of Eco-Friendly Shoes
Reduced carbon footprint: Eco-friendly shoes often use sustainable and ecological materials, such as vegan leather, organic cotton, and natural rubber, which require fewer natural resources and emit fewer greenhouse gases than traditional synthetic materials.
Conservation of natural resources: By opting for sustainable and recycled materials, eco-friendly shoes help reduce deforestation, excessive land use, and the depletion of natural resources, which is essential for preserving our planet's fragile ecosystems.
Waste reduction: Many eco-friendly shoes are designed to be recyclable or biodegradable, which means they have a smaller impact on landfills and disposal sites at the end of their useful life, thus helping to reduce plastic and textile waste.
Support for ethical practices: Eco-friendly shoe brands often have transparent and ethical manufacturing practices, ensuring that workers are treated fairly and that working conditions are safe and respectful.
Eco-Friendly Shoe Options
Today, there are multiple eco-friendly shoe options on the market to suit all styles and needs. From organic cotton sneakers to vegan leather boots, to sandals made from recycled rubber, consumers are spoiled for choice when it comes to selecting environmentally friendly footwear.
